Community Resources

If you or someone you know is experiencing homelessness, poverty, or incarceration, these are some organizations within the Las Vegas community that may be able to help. 

Feed My Sheep Resource Book

This resource book, compiled by Feed My Sheep, has a large directory of services for housing, mental health and addiction care, domestic violence support, and more.

UNLV: Student Support Spot

The Student Support Spot offers food, toiletries, guidance, and more to students in need. No proof of student status is required. 

Location: University Gateway Building
4700 S. Maryland Pkwy. Ste. 200
Las Vegas, NV 89119

Hope for Prisoners

Supports incarcerated people in re-integrating with their community and finding employment.

The LGBTQ Center of Southern Nevada

Provides free health care, education, community, and support in accessing benefits to LGBTQ individuals and their families.

Location: 401 S. Maryland Parkway,
Las Vegas, NV 89101

Hope Means Nevada

This team aims to eliminate teen suicide in Las Vegas by reaching out to youth, encouraging mental health care, and providing accessible resources. 

Shannon West Homeless Youth Shelter

Provides stable housing, food, case management, education assistance, and more for vulnerable people aged 16-24.
